How to Set Up Business Phones from Unboxing to Full Deployment

If you’ve ever inherited a phone deployment with no documentation, no standard process, and 47 different device models on the network — you already know why a repeatable business phone set up matters. This guide is for the IT manager who wants to do it right the first time, or fix it the second time around.

A proper business phone setup isn’t just about getting devices into employees’ hands. It’s about building a process that scales — one you can run for 10 devices or 10,000 without it falling apart. Each step below builds on the last, and skipping any of them is usually where deployments get messy.

Step 1: Choose the Right Devices for Your Business

Device selection is where most deployments go wrong before they even start. IT teams either spec too high (paying for flagship hardware nobody needs), too low (cheap devices that create support tickets for the next three years), or they let employees self-select and end up managing a zoo of models.

A few questions worth answering before you pick anything:

  • What’s the primary use case — voice, field data entry, mobile POS, remote access, something else?
  • Does your MDM platform have any hardware requirements or known compatibility issues?
  • Do you need carrier-specific devices, or can you use factory-unlocked hardware across multiple networks?
  • What’s your refresh cycle, and how does device cost fit into a 3-year TCO calculation?

For most mid-market deployments, a standardized mid-range Android fleet — Samsung Galaxy A-series or Motorola business-line devices — hits the right balance of cost, reliability, and MDM support. If your environment is iOS, Apple devices enrolled through Apple Business Manager give you a clean, well-documented enrollment path. Factory-unlocked devices are almost always preferable to carrier-locked hardware — you’re not tied to one network, and you’re not fighting carrier bloatware during enrollment.

Check the Android Enterprise Recommended device list if you’re building an Android fleet — it’s a practical shortlist of hardware that’s been validated for enterprise MDM use.

Step 2: Choose and Configure Your MDM Platform

Your MDM platform is the backbone of the whole deployment. The device side of this is only as good as your management layer.

The major platforms — Microsoft Intune, Jamf (for Apple-heavy environments), VMware Workspace ONE, and SOTI — each have strengths depending on your OS mix, existing infrastructure, and IT team’s familiarity. There’s no universal right answer, but a few practical notes:

  • If your org is already in the Microsoft 365 ecosystem, Intune is usually the path of least resistance.
  • If you’re managing a mixed fleet of Android and iOS, make sure your chosen platform handles both without requiring separate consoles.
  • Confirm your MDM supports the enrollment methods you’re planning to use before you’re halfway through a rollout.

Configure your baseline policies before a single device is enrolled. App allowlists, password requirements, encryption enforcement, network configurations — all of that should be built and tested in a staging environment first.

Step 3: Pick Your Enrollment Method

Enrollment is where business phone setup either goes smoothly or eats your week. The method you choose matters as much as the platform.

Android Zero-Touch Enrollment

Zero-touch enrollment lets you pre-configure devices so they automatically enroll in your MDM the moment an employee powers them on and connects to Wi-Fi. No IT hands-on-keyboard per device. You associate devices with your zero-touch account at the supplier level — which means if you’re buying from a zero-touch reseller, devices arrive essentially pre-enrolled. For Android fleets of any real size, this is the standard.

Samsung Knox Mobile Enrollment

Knox Mobile Enrollment is Samsung’s proprietary enrollment layer on top of Android Enterprise. It adds bulk device upload via IMEI, deeper hardware-level policy enforcement, and tighter integration with Samsung’s security stack. For heavily regulated environments — healthcare, government, financial services — Knox-validated devices give you more control than standard Android enrollment. Knox and zero-touch aren’t mutually exclusive; many deployments use both.

Apple Business Manager (ABM)

Apple Business Manager is Apple’s equivalent — a web portal where you manage device enrollment, app licensing, and content distribution at the organizational level. Devices purchased through an ABM-authorized reseller get assigned to your MDM automatically. Employees don’t touch a setup assistant — they power on and land directly in a managed state.

The common thread across all three: they only work if your devices were sourced through the right channel. A carrier-locked device bought retail often can’t be enrolled via these methods, or requires extra steps that defeat the whole purpose.

Step 4: Configure Apps and Policies

Once enrollment is confirmed in a test environment, build out your configuration profiles. This is the layer most IT teams underestimate in terms of time.

Work through it in logical order:

  • Security baseline first: screen lock, encryption, minimum OS version, certificate deployment.
  • Network configs: Wi-Fi profiles, VPN, proxy settings — pushed silently, no employee action required.
  • App deployment: required apps pushed automatically, optional apps available through a managed app catalog. Don’t push everything to everyone — scope apps to device groups or job roles.
  • Restrictions: disable what doesn’t belong — USB debugging, app sideloading, unmanaged app installs — based on your compliance requirements and use case.

Document every policy decision and the reason for it. Six months from now, someone will ask why a particular restriction exists. If you don’t have a record, you’ll spend time reverse-engineering your own config.

Step 5: Stage and Kit Devices Before Deployment

Staging is the difference between a deployment that goes smoothly and one where you’re fielding calls from employees on day one because their phone isn’t set up right.

A proper staging process means: devices are enrolled, policies are applied, apps are downloaded and verified, and the device is confirmed in a known-good state before it ever leaves IT. Ideally you’re doing this in batches — power on a rack of devices, confirm enrollment, spot-check a sample for policy compliance, then box and label for distribution.

This is also where your supplier matters. Devices that arrive with a consistent hardware state — same firmware version, factory reset, no carrier pre-installs, QC-verified — stage predictably. Devices that arrive with inconsistencies (different OS builds, partial setups, undisclosed cosmetic damage) introduce variables that slow everything down. If your volume is high enough, ask your supplier about pre-enrollment staging — some can associate IMEIs with your zero-touch or Knox account before the devices even ship. That takes another step off your plate entirely.

Step 6: Employee Handoff and Documentation

The last step is the one most IT teams rush, and it shows. A device handoff without documentation creates a support burden that accumulates over time.

At minimum, employees should receive:

  • A one-page quick-start guide: how to access work apps, what IT manages on the device, who to call if something’s wrong.
  • An acceptable use policy acknowledgment — signed, on file.
  • Clear instructions on what to do if the device is lost, stolen, or damaged.

On the IT side, every issued device should be logged — serial number, IMEI, assigned user, enrollment date, configuration profile applied. If you’re using your MDM’s asset management features, this happens automatically. If not, a maintained spreadsheet is better than nothing.

Build a device return and offboarding process at the same time you build the handoff process. Wiping and re-enrolling returned devices is part of the lifecycle, not an afterthought.
